About Commercial Litigation Law in Munger, India
Commercial litigation in Munger, India, refers to the process of using legal means to resolve disputes that arise from business or commercial transactions. These disputes typically involve issues like breach of contracts, partnership disagreements, recovery of dues, disputes between companies, and other matters related to business activities. Munger, as a city in Bihar, follows the same legal framework as the rest of India under the Commercial Courts Act, 2015 and other procedural laws like the Code of Civil Procedure, 1908. The legal landscape is enforced through local District Courts, as well as specialized Commercial Courts established as per government notifications. Understanding the local nuances, court procedures, and business customs is vital for navigating commercial litigation in Munger effectively.

Local Laws Overview
Commercial disputes in Munger are governed by central laws like the Indian Contract Act, 1872; Companies Act, 2013; the Sale of Goods Act, 1930; Partnership Act, 1932; and the Commercial Courts Act, 2015. The Commercial Courts Act specifically provides for setting up commercial courts at the district level in notified areas, including certain districts in Bihar.
These courts have jurisdiction over disputes where the value of subject matter is more than three lakh rupees and relate to commercial matters such as trade, commerce, construction contracts, insurance, banking, and more. Proceedings in these courts are generally faster due to strict timelines. Additionally, any appeals against orders of commercial courts in Munger typically lie to the High Court having jurisdiction in Bihar.
It is also important to be aware of local business licensing regulations, taxation laws (including Goods and Services Tax), and Munger’s municipal regulations if the dispute relates to local business operations. Language and documentation are often key, so court filings and evidence must comply with procedural requirements set by local courts.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is considered a commercial dispute in Munger?
A commercial dispute involves issues arising from business or commercial transactions, such as contract enforcement, debt recovery, partnerships, company disputes, intellectual property, banking, and similar matters between parties engaged in business.
Where are commercial litigation cases heard in Munger?
Commercial litigation cases are heard either in the District Court of Munger or the designated Commercial Court if the subject matter falls under the Commercial Courts Act, 2015.
Do I need a lawyer to file a commercial case in Munger?
While the law does not strictly require a lawyer, commercial matters are usually complex, and it is highly advisable to engage a legal expert to navigate procedures, present evidence, and argue your case effectively.
How long does it take to resolve a commercial litigation case in Munger?
While timelines depend on case complexity and the court’s schedule, commercial courts generally aim to resolve cases faster than regular courts, often within one to two years, adhering to strict procedural timelines.
Can disputes be settled out of court?
Yes, parties are encouraged to settle disputes through negotiation, mediation, or arbitration before or during court proceedings. Courts may also refer certain cases to local mediation centers.
What are the usual costs involved in commercial litigation in Munger?
Costs include court fees, lawyer’s fees, documentation charges, and any expenses related to witnesses and expert opinions. The specific amount depends on the value and complexity of the dispute.
Can I appeal a decision from the Commercial Court in Munger?
Yes, appeals against decisions of the Commercial Court typically go to the Patna High Court, subject to the value of the dispute and legal grounds for appeal.
What documents are necessary for filing a commercial case?
Common documents include contracts or agreements, invoices, correspondence, proof of transactions, business registration certificates, and any written evidence supporting your claim.
Is there a time limit for filing a commercial suit in Munger?
Yes, limitation periods apply as per the Limitation Act, 1963. Civil and commercial suits should be filed within three years from when the cause of action arises, though specific disputes may have different timelines.
Can foreign companies file commercial litigation cases in Munger?
Yes, foreign companies can file suits in Munger if the dispute has a connection to India or the concerned business dealings occurred within the jurisdiction of Munger.
